STAINLESS STEEL DOOR KNOCKERS
PROVING POPULAR CHOICE
» » THE TROJAN GROUP
added two door knockers to its
renowned Stainless Steel range
last year and they are proving
to be a popular addition. Tony
Chadwick, Trojan’s Group
Managing Director, said: “The
aim of the Slim Urn Door
Knocker and the Contemporary
Door Knocker was to increase
the number of design choices
on offer and help bring Trojan
quality to a wider audience.
Sales suggest we’ve done exactly
that.”
They have been designed with
the installer in mind because they
are face fixed so there is no need
to drill through the door, making
installation quicker and easier.
Both have a slimline
contemporary design that will
appeal to today’s discerning
consumer. Both suite with all the
other products in the Stainless-
Steel range to provide a totally
coordinated approach. Both
are available in a full choice of
finishes including Polished/
Brushed Gold (PVD), Polished/
Brushed Stainless, White and
Black. And, perhaps most
importantly, like all the products
in the Stainless-Steel range, both
products come with a 25-year
anti-corrosion guarantee.

New Warehouse Expansion
» » CAMBRIDGESHIRE BASED WINDOW
and door hardware specialist, Mighton Products,
has announced the completion of a new
warehouse that will allow it to expand its existing
on-site warehousing capacity and help cater
for increased demand from new and existing
customers.
The company, which is the UK’s oldest
established sash window hardware specialist,
manufactures and distributes a wide range of
products, including those designed specially for
the timber sash and casement window market,
and says the addition of the warehouse is part of
a larger expansion plan that will aim to further
improve and expand its product offering.
Mighton’s Chairman, Mike Derham said:
“We already offer a comprehensive range of
over 2,000 market leading sash, casement and
door products, and the completion of our new
warehouse, which started in February this year,
is part of a larger investment that will allow us
to develop that offering even further, including
our new and exclusive Mighton Ultra range of
exterior paints and coatings for joinery, as well
as range of high quality portable woodworking
machines for joinery. The introduction of the
new warehouse will also allow us to offer a bigger
and better trade counter for our customers.”

Emergency hardware
supports safety standards
» » ESTABLISHED HARDWARE
supplier Carl F Groupco is
promoting its extensive range
of panic and emergency exit
gearing, which meets stringent
safety standards for public and
commercial installations.
Commenting on the
importance of offering support
to the hardware sector, John
Mitchell, Carl F Groupco’s
Technical Manager explains:
“It can be time consuming
for fabricators to translate
standards into hardware selection
– recognising this, we ensure
that we are well versed in the
regulations that impact this
process and ensure we are fully
equipped to advise customers on
the best route to achieve panic or
emergency exit doors.

“It’s important to establish
exactly where the door set
will be fitted and who will be
using it - this will determine
what hardware is required to
meet regulations. Non-public
buildings, for example, where
potential users have received
full door operation training,
require hardware to meet the
EN 179 standard for emergency
exits. However, if the door is to
be fitted to public buildings or
other premises where occupants
may not be familiar with exit
routes and hardware devices, the
door will need to meet EN 1125
for panic exit.”
